Description

Butane-2,3-Diamine Hydrochloride is a high-purity, crystalline salt derivative of a chiral diamine, valued for its role as a versatile building block in organic synthesis. This compound is essential for creating complex molecular architectures, particularly in the development of chiral ligands, catalysts, and active pharmaceutical ingredients (APIs). It serves critical needs in the pharmaceutical, agrochemical, and specialty chemical industries where precise stereochemistry and high-purity intermediates are required.

Application

  • Pharmaceutical Intermediate: Key chiral building block for the synthesis of active pharmaceutical ingredients (APIs), especially in antiviral and antibiotic drug development.
  • Catalyst & Ligand Synthesis: Used to prepare chiral ligands for asymmetric catalysis, enhancing the efficiency and selectivity of chemical reactions.
  • Agrochemical Research: Intermediate in the production of advanced herbicides, fungicides, and plant growth regulators.
  • Complexing Agent: Serves as a precursor for chelating agents used in metal ion sequestration and analytical chemistry.
  • Polymer Modification: Employed in the synthesis of specialty polyamides and polymers with tailored properties.
  • Bioconjugation & Peptide Chemistry: Useful in modifying biomolecules and synthesizing peptide analogs for research and diagnostic applications.

Basic Information

Product Name Butane-2,3-Diamine Hydrochloride
CAS No. 55536-62-4
Molecular Formula C4H12N2·HCl or C4H13ClN2
Molecular Weight 124.62 g/mol
Synonyms 2,3-Diaminobutane Hydrochloride; (2R,3R)-(+)-2,3-Diaminobutane Dihydrochloride; (2S,3S)-(-)-2,3-Diaminobutane Dihydrochloride; meso-2,3-Diaminobutane Hydrochloride; Butane-2,3-diyldiamine hydrochloride; 1,2-Diamino-1-methylpropane Hydrochloride; DL-2,3-Diaminobutane Hydrochloride; 2,3-Butanediamine Hydrochloride

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ed to prevent moisture absorption. Keep away from incompatible materials such as strong oxidizing agents.
